#f3b4ba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f3b4ba is composed of 95.3% red, 70.6% green and 72.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 25.9% magenta, 23.5%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 354.3 degrees, a saturation of 72.4% and a lightness of 82.9%. #f3b4ba color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#e76975.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

Shades and Tints of #f3b4ba

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0202 is the darkest color, while #fef8f8 is the lightest one.
